    Bajaj Finance aims at ₹10 lakh-cr loan book by FY29; likely to look within for next MD

    Bajaj Finance is preparing for a leadership transition. Rajeev Jain's successor will be an internal candidate. The company aims to finalize succession plans within six months. Jain's term extends until March 2028. Bajaj Finance targets significant growth. They project a profit of ₹43,000 crore by FY29. The firm also plans to expand its customer base substantially.

    SpiceJet shares fall 5% after airline reports Rs 234 crore net loss in Q1FY26

    SpiceJet Share Price: SpiceJet reported a net loss of Rupees 234 crore in the first quarter of fiscal year 2026. This is a reversal from last year's profit. Revenue also declined significantly. Geopolitical issues and aircraft delays impacted performance. Passenger revenue and load factor remained relatively stable. The airline's net worth improved due to financial restructuring.
